These Twin Towers Were Not Destroyed By Terrorists
It turns out that Twin Tower architecture is a common design in the late 20th and early 21st centuries. The Minoru Yamasaki design that was destroyed on September 11, 2001 may be the most famous.
Another pair of towers, the Petronas Towers in Malaysia, were built by Cesar Pelli in 1998.
The Petronas Towers are the tallest pair of towers in the world, but soon will be outranked by the Incheon 151 Tower under construction in South Korea. The Incheon twin towers are connected by "sky bridges." Designed by John Portman and Associates, Incheon Tower is expected to be the tallest Twin Tower in the world.
